Camera Lens

When I switch the camera on the lens will only come out a short way and then immediately goes back in again the batteries are new so its not that, I took 2 photos with it which was fine and then this problem started please help

ENGLISH Back view 1 234 5 6 14 13 optional 7 8 9 10 12 11 1 LCD 2 Review button 3 Menu button 4 LCD/Info button 5 Delete button 6 Zoom button (Telephoto/Wide) 7 Strap post 8 9 OK button 10 Share button 11 Battery compartment 12 Slot for optional SD or MMC card 13 Dock connector 14 Tripod socket www.kodak.com/go/c613support 7
